Transaction 87902628462891585dd325c938725196fec71602afc30cef2d2e91582c6e1285

1 Input
2 Outputs
  • 87902628462891585dd325c938725196fec71602afc30cef2d2e91582c6e1285:0
  • value  1650000
    address  3Pp5q4Hw7gsLyJh5BArUTF5uPjFtJENGeK
  • 87902628462891585dd325c938725196fec71602afc30cef2d2e91582c6e1285:1
  • value  5338892070
    address  161Vp88Xie6PKTYcfrzSd8gp6iAoPqqgJT